CU Members Mortgage, the mortgage loan origination and servicing firm that is a division of Colonial Savings Bank, is celebrating its 30th anniversary this year and will formally mark the accomplishment at its 15th National Mortgage Lending Conference on Monday and Tuesday in Fort Worth, Texas.

The privately held, Dallas-based firm remains family owned and reported originating more than $2 billion in 2011 with partner credit unions. The firm said it closed its first CU affiliated mortgage loan in 1982 for less than $100,000 and has grown to more than 1,000 affiliated CUs.

“It's been a wonderful ride helping credit unions over the years with their mortgage services,” said Linda Clampitt, senior vice president of CU Members Mortgage, who's been with the company since 1993. “We see this as a much-needed service in today's financial marketplace that allows credit unions to readily compete with their counterparts, help navigate the constant flow of new regulations, and fully serve their members to achieve the dream of owning a home,” Clampitt said.
